BUFFALO WORSHIP (Part 3)
Canon AE-1 (busted lense or light meter?)
Kodak ColorPlus ISO 200

Thai water buffalo are revered (and infamous) across the country for their resilience in times of austerity; stemmed from ancient nomadic animal husbandry. Some ancient nomadic keepers were found to be buried with the buffalo remains as well as psychedelic mushrooms their "waste" would produce, cementing their reverence in history.

Concurrent to the awe inspiring divinity, they are equally infamous for magic imagery.

The dark malavolent side, Kwai Tanu ( buffalo arrow) is used to destroy the chosen victim. It is created with grave dirt, other funeral rites materials, human ashes/bones sourced from violent deaths, as well as sacred metals; all materials related to death rites. Kwai Tanu can be used as an assassin.

Venture into the light, Kwai Tanu can also be used as a guardian or ally to protect you and your home from its dark counter-part.

Ive eaten their flesh, placenta, and feet. It was only in my interest to assimilate and not offend locals in the Northern mountains of Thailand.

These photos were taken at Suphanburi Thai Water Buffalo Conservation Center. Although buffalo were fully native wild animals at one point, theyre fully domesticated now. The center has 100s of buffalo from various situations. Rescued, bought, bred. They're all well taken care of and are reminiscent of big dogs and the care takers treat them as such.
